Discovery / Monitoring without root access
Hello,
is there a way to discover and monitor Linux-Systems without root credentials?
Or even to delete the root cerdentials after discovery?

Re: Discovery / Monitoring without root access
Hi,
There is a way... Connect to the Systems Management Homepage (https://server:2381) of the Linux server, go to security and import the certificate from your SIM server...
From that moment on, your SIM server can communicate in a secure ay with your Linux server without needing the root account...
The Linux guys in my company do not want to give the root password but working like this gives me all functionality and they are also satisfied...
